Not for Everyone

We stayed here the week before Xmas, and had the place entirely to ourselves. Even the hotel staff left at 5 PM for the night, and we were the only people in the place! There is no room service, and the restaurant is open only Thurs-Sun. The nearest place to eat is 15 miles away, but the hotel did have a cont. bkfst. But the grounds and facilities are fantastic! The rooms were all redone (paint, furniture, etc) in Jan 07, and I don’t think ours had been stayed in since. The pool is beautiful, altho we never used it. Front desk staff was helpful and friendly. If you have a boat, bring it! No golf we saw, but easy access to the Everglades. If you have to be waited on, go somewhere else. But if you can get by with a minimum of service and enjoy solitude, this is the place.

Traveler's tip on dining

Eat at Triad’s in Everglades City, or go to Marco Island. The Depot in E.C. was poor.

Past its prime

We found this place from a 2006 (1 yr old) guide book that called it a "Full Service Resort" in the "Ultra Deluxe" category. In reality it was like a standard 2 star motel. No restaurant (there was an old one there that looks like it hasn’t opened in years). The spa was a "mobile" spa and the schedule was listed at the front desk. Rooms were clean with DVD player (a big plus), fridge, microwave. Beds were comfortable. Deck is shared with ALL other rooms (its a veranda that wraps around...people walking right by your room door). Front desk was neither rude nor helpful. All rooms on 2nd floor.
